What to tell someone who thinks they are not enough?

Give them positive feedback. Tell your friend or relative about his or her strengths, accomplishments and assets. This will let them know that you think they are important enough to remember these things, as well as help them learn to positively reinforce their own behavior. Express your care and concern.

When someone thinks they're not good enough?

A feeling of not being good enough often indicates that a person has low self-esteem. Self-esteem is a personality construct defined by how a person perceives their self-meaning, self-identity, self-image, and self-concepts.

How do you tell someone they are worth more than they think?

Be specific: Identify specific qualities or skills that you admire in the person and explain why you think they are valuable. For example, "I've noticed that you have a real talent for connecting with people. You're a great listener and really empathize with others, which is a valuable skill in any situation."

What do you say to comfort someone?

Helpful things to say
  • "Can you tell me more about what's going on?"
  • "If you want to tell me more, I'm here to listen"
  • "I've noticed you haven't been yourself, is there anything on your mind?"
  • "I can see this is hard for you to open up about. It's ok to take your time. I'm not in any rush"

What makes someone feel like they are not enough?

Sometimes we feel like we're not good enough because we're comparing ourselves to others who are in different circ*mstances. We may also be comparing our own weaknesses to another person's strengths. It's important to remember that everyone has their own unique journey.

What do you say to someone who doesn't feel worthy?

“Validate these negative feelings and let them feel heard. Then you can move on to offer a positive opinion about how they look.” Try not to say things like 'You're fine the way you are', or 'Don't worry about it', as this doesn't give them space to express how they feel.

What causes inadequacy?

Inadequacy refers to an individual's perception of their own value in various situations. It is often related to self-image, and it can arise due to several factors, including early experiences, personality traits, comparisons with others, and mental health challenges.

What is deep seated feelings of inadequacy?

Someone with an inferiority complex has deep-seated feelings of inadequacy across different aspects of their lives. They may constantly compare themselves to others, withdraw from social or competitive situations, or put others down in an attempt to feel better about themselves.

How do you make someone realize they hurt you?

5 Steps for Telling Someone They Hurt or Disrespected You
  1. Start with why what you want to say is important. ...
  2. Briefly describe what happened that felt hurtful or disrespectful. ...
  3. Say how their behavior made you feel—the impact. ...
  4. Ask for what you need going forward. ...
  5. End by reinforcing why you are making this request.

When should you stop trying to fix a relationship?

Some signs that it is time to end the relationship include:
  1. You've both stopped trying.
  2. There is no emotional or physical connection or intimacy.
  3. You have differing goals in life.
  4. You no longer trust each other.
  5. You can't imagine a future together.
  6. There is constant conflict or abuse in the relationship.
